#e370d2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e370d2 is composed of 89% red, 43.9%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.7% magenta, 7.5%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 308.9 degrees, a saturation of 67.3% and a lightness of 66.5%. #e370d2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e0ff with #c700a5.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#e370d2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050104 is the darkest color, while #fdf3f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#e370d2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aea5ad is the less saturated color, while #fd56e5 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#e370d2 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#9e9e9e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#ac95a8 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#7f9dee Protanopia 1% of men
  • #979dc9 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#db8791 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#a38ce4 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#b28ccc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#de7fa8 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
